How to Add, Remove, and Disable Extensions in Microsoft Edge
Microsoft Edge, built on the Chromium engine, offers a robust and customizable browsing experience, largely due to its extensive support for extensions. These add-ons can significantly enhance productivity, security, and entertainment by introducing new features or modifying existing ones. Understanding how to manage these extensions—adding new ones, removing those you no longer need, and temporarily disabling others—is key to optimizing your browser’s performance and functionality.
This comprehensive guide will walk you through every step of managing your Microsoft Edge extensions, ensuring you can tailor your browser precisely to your needs. We will cover the process from discovering and installing new tools to decluttering your browser by removing unwanted add-ons, and even how to temporarily disable extensions to troubleshoot issues or conserve resources.
Accessing the Extensions Management Page
The central hub for all your extension management activities in Microsoft Edge is the Extensions page. This is where you can view, enable, disable, and remove all installed add-ons. To access this crucial page, you’ll typically navigate through the browser’s main menu.
Click on the three horizontal dots, often referred to as the “Settings and more” menu, located in the top-right corner of the Edge window. From the dropdown menu that appears, hover over “Extensions.” A sub-menu will then display your installed extensions, along with an option to “Manage extensions.” Clicking this will open the dedicated Extensions page in a new tab.
Alternatively, you can directly type `edge://extensions` into the address bar and press Enter. This shortcut will instantly take you to the same management page, providing a quicker route for experienced users.
Adding New Extensions
Microsoft Edge supports extensions from the Microsoft Edge Add-ons store and, due to its Chromium foundation, also from the Chrome Web Store. This dual compatibility significantly expands the range of available tools.
Discovering Extensions in the Microsoft Edge Add-ons Store
The official Microsoft Edge Add-ons store is the primary and recommended source for extensions. It’s curated to ensure a baseline level of quality and security. To browse this store, navigate to the Extensions page we just discussed.
On the Extensions page, you will find a prominent link or button, usually labeled “Get extensions for Microsoft Edge” or “Microsoft Edge Add-ons.” Clicking this will direct you to the official store website. Here, you can search for specific extensions by name or category, or simply explore popular and featured add-ons.
Once you find an extension that interests you, click on its listing to view its details. This page typically includes a description, screenshots, user reviews, and information about permissions the extension requires. If you decide to install it, click the “Get” button. A confirmation dialog will appear, detailing the permissions the extension needs. Review these carefully before clicking “Add extension” to proceed with the installation.
Utilizing Extensions from the Chrome Web Store
Microsoft Edge’s compatibility with Chrome extensions means you can also leverage the vast library available on the Chrome Web Store. However, there’s a small, initial setup step required to enable this functionality.
First, navigate to the Extensions management page in Edge (`edge://extensions`). On this page, you’ll find a toggle switch, usually in the bottom-left corner, labeled “Allow extensions from other stores.” You need to enable this toggle. A warning prompt will appear, informing you about the risks of installing extensions from outside the official Microsoft store. Confirm that you wish to proceed.
With this setting enabled, you can now visit the Chrome Web Store in Edge. Browse or search for extensions as you normally would. When you find an extension you want, click the “Add to Chrome” button. Edge will then display a prompt similar to the one for the Edge Add-ons store, listing the permissions required. Click “Add extension” to install it into Edge.
Understanding Extension Permissions
When installing any extension, whether from the Edge Add-ons store or the Chrome Web Store, you will be presented with a list of permissions the extension requires. These permissions dictate what data the extension can access and what actions it can perform within your browser.
Common permissions include the ability to “Read and change all your data on the websites you visit,” which allows an extension to interact with web pages. Others might be more specific, like “Read your browsing history” or “Access your tabs and browsing activity.” It is crucial to understand what each permission means and whether it aligns with the extension’s stated purpose.
For example, a password manager extension will naturally need broad access to read and change data on websites to autofill login credentials. Conversely, a simple calculator extension probably shouldn’t require access to your browsing history. If an extension’s requested permissions seem excessive or unrelated to its function, it’s a red flag, and you should reconsider installing it.
Managing Newly Installed Extensions
After installation, new extensions often appear as an icon in the toolbar, usually to the right of the address bar. Some extensions might automatically integrate into the browser without a visible icon, while others might require initial configuration.
You can pin or unpin extension icons to the toolbar for easy access. To do this, click the puzzle piece icon (Extensions icon) to the right of the address bar. This will reveal a list of your installed extensions. Next to each extension, there’s a pin icon. Clicking this icon will either pin the extension’s icon to the toolbar or unpin it, depending on its current state.
Some extensions also have their own options pages, which you can access from the Extensions management page or by right-clicking the extension’s icon on the toolbar (if available) and selecting “Options.” This is where you can customize the extension’s behavior, set preferences, or log in to an associated account.
Removing Unwanted Extensions
Over time, you might find that some extensions are no longer useful, are causing performance issues, or you simply don’t use them anymore. Removing these unwanted extensions is a straightforward process that helps keep your browser clean and efficient.
Locating Extensions for Removal
The first step to removing an extension is to access the Extensions management page. As previously detailed, you can do this by typing `edge://extensions` into the address bar or by navigating through the “Settings and more” menu (three dots > Extensions > Manage extensions).
Once on the Extensions page, you will see a list of all installed extensions. Each extension will have its own card or entry, displaying its name, icon, and a brief description. This is your control panel for managing all add-ons.
Carefully review the list to identify the specific extension you wish to remove. Ensure you are certain about the extension you are targeting, as removing the wrong one might require you to reinstall it later.
The Uninstallation Process
Each extension listed on the management page will have a “Remove” button or a trash can icon associated with it. Click this button or icon for the extension you want to uninstall.
After clicking “Remove,” a confirmation dialog box will appear. This dialog is a safeguard to prevent accidental removals. It will typically ask you to confirm that you want to remove the extension and may briefly reiterate the extension’s name. You might also see an option to report the extension if you are removing it due to malicious behavior or other concerns.
Click the “Remove” or “Confirm” button in the dialog box to complete the uninstallation. The extension will be immediately removed from your browser, and its icon will disappear from the toolbar if it was previously visible.
Post-Removal Cleanup
Once an extension is removed, its associated files and settings are deleted from your Edge profile. This action frees up system resources and can sometimes resolve browser performance issues or conflicts that the extension might have been causing.
It’s good practice to restart your browser after removing extensions, especially if you were experiencing problems. This ensures that all changes are fully applied and that no lingering processes related to the removed extension remain active.
Check if the issue that prompted the removal is resolved. If you removed an extension because you suspected it was causing slow loading times or other glitches, a restart and the removal itself should ideally fix the problem.
Disabling Extensions Temporarily
There are times when you might not want to permanently remove an extension, but rather disable it temporarily. This is particularly useful for troubleshooting browser issues, conserving system resources, or simply when you don’t need the extension’s functionality for a specific task.
Identifying When to Disable
Disabling extensions is an excellent first step when diagnosing browser problems. If your browser is crashing, websites are not loading correctly, or you’re experiencing unexpected behavior, one or more extensions could be the culprit. By disabling them one by one, you can pinpoint the problematic add-on without losing it entirely.
Another common scenario is when extensions consume a significant amount of memory or CPU resources, slowing down your computer. Temporarily disabling these resource-heavy extensions can improve browser performance, allowing you to work more efficiently.
You might also choose to disable extensions if they interfere with specific websites or online tools you use. For instance, a content blocker might prevent a particular news site from displaying correctly, or a productivity tool might conflict with a web application.
The Disabling Mechanism
To disable an extension, navigate back to the Extensions management page (`edge://extensions`). Each extension listed on this page has a toggle switch, usually located near its name or icon. This toggle controls whether the extension is currently active or inactive.
Click the toggle switch for the extension you wish to disable. When the switch is turned off (it typically turns gray or moves to the left), the extension is disabled. Its icon will disappear from the toolbar, and its functionality will cease until you re-enable it.
You can disable multiple extensions simultaneously by repeating this process for each one. This is a highly effective method for isolating a problematic extension.
Re-enabling Disabled Extensions
Re-enabling an extension is just as simple as disabling it. Return to the Extensions management page (`edge://extensions`). Locate the extension that you previously disabled.
You will see that the toggle switch for the disabled extension is in the “off” position. Click this toggle switch again. It will move to the “on” position (often turning blue or moving to the right), and the extension will be immediately re-enabled. Its icon should reappear on the toolbar if it was previously pinned or visible.
Once re-enabled, the extension will resume its normal operation, and any settings or configurations you had previously applied will be restored. This allows for quick switching between enabled and disabled states without losing your customizations.
Managing Extension Icons and Visibility
The toolbar area of Microsoft Edge can become cluttered with extension icons, making it difficult to find the icons for the browser’s built-in features or your most-used extensions.
The Extension Icon Menu
Microsoft Edge, like other Chromium-based browsers, consolidates most extension icons into a single puzzle-piece icon. Clicking this icon reveals a dropdown menu listing all your installed extensions. This helps keep the main toolbar cleaner.
Extensions that you frequently use can be pinned directly to the toolbar for immediate access. To do this, click the puzzle-piece icon, find the desired extension in the list, and click the pin icon next to it. The extension’s icon will then appear permanently on the toolbar.
Conversely, you can unpin extensions from the toolbar by clicking the puzzle-piece icon again and clicking the unpin icon next to a pinned extension. This moves its icon back into the main extension menu.
Customizing Toolbar Appearance
Beyond pinning and unpinning, some extensions offer their own in-browser settings to control their visibility or behavior. Always check an extension’s options page for such customizations.
You can also manage the overall appearance of the Edge toolbar by right-clicking on empty space within the toolbar area. This might reveal options to customize toolbars, though direct extension icon management is primarily handled through the puzzle-piece menu.
Ensuring that only essential extension icons are visible on the toolbar can significantly improve the usability and aesthetic appeal of your browsing environment.
Troubleshooting Extension Issues
Extensions are powerful tools, but they can occasionally cause problems. Knowing how to troubleshoot these issues is vital for maintaining a smooth browsing experience.
Identifying Problematic Extensions
If you encounter unusual browser behavior, such as slow performance, crashes, or website display errors, extensions are often the first place to look. The most effective method for identifying a problematic extension is to disable them all and then re-enable them one by one.
Start by disabling all extensions via the `edge://extensions` page. Then, close and reopen Edge. If the problem disappears, you know an extension was the cause. Next, re-enable one extension, restart Edge, and test. Repeat this process, re-enabling extensions in small groups or individually, until the problem reappears. The last extension you enabled is likely the culprit.
Alternatively, some extensions might log errors or provide diagnostic information within their own options pages. Checking these can sometimes offer clues about conflicts or malfunctions.
Clearing Extension Data and Cache
Sometimes, an extension might malfunction due to corrupted data or an outdated cache. While extensions don’t have a central cache-clearing mechanism like the browser itself, some extensions might offer a “reset settings” or “clear cache” option within their individual options pages.
If an extension has such an option, using it can resolve issues stemming from corrupted internal data. This is a more targeted approach than clearing the entire browser cache, which might affect other sites and extensions.
Always refer to the specific extension’s documentation or options page for any data or cache management features it provides.
Reporting Problematic Extensions
If you determine an extension is malicious, consistently buggy, or violates store policies, you have the option to report it. This helps Microsoft and the community maintain a safer extension ecosystem.
To report an extension, navigate to its listing in the Microsoft Edge Add-ons store. On the extension’s details page, look for a “Report abuse” or similar link. Clicking this will usually open a form where you can provide details about the issue.
For extensions installed from the Chrome Web Store, you can report them directly through the Chrome Web Store’s interface. Reporting helps ensure that problematic add-ons are reviewed and potentially removed from circulation.
Advanced Extension Management
Beyond basic adding, removing, and disabling, there are more advanced aspects to managing extensions that can further refine your browsing experience.
Managing Extension Updates
Microsoft Edge automatically checks for and installs updates for your extensions in the background. This ensures you always have the latest features and security patches without manual intervention.
However, you can manually trigger an update check. Go to `edge://extensions` and enable “Developer mode” using the toggle in the bottom-left corner. Once developer mode is on, you will see an “Update” button appear at the top of the page. Clicking this will force Edge to check for and install any available updates for all installed extensions.
Keeping extensions updated is crucial for security, as updates often patch vulnerabilities that malicious actors could exploit. It also ensures compatibility with the latest browser versions and web standards.
Understanding Developer Mode
Enabling “Developer mode” on the `edge://extensions` page unlocks additional features, primarily intended for developers creating their own extensions. However, it can be useful for advanced users as well.
In developer mode, you can load unpacked extensions (folders containing extension code), pack extensions into a `.crx` file for distribution, and view detailed extension IDs. It also enables the manual update button mentioned earlier.
While generally safe, be cautious when enabling developer mode, especially if you are not actively developing extensions. Ensure you understand the implications of the features it unlocks.
Extension Conflicts and Resolution
Occasionally, two or more extensions might conflict with each other, leading to unpredictable behavior. This often happens when extensions try to modify the same browser elements or perform similar functions.
The primary method for resolving extension conflicts is the disable-and-re-enable strategy described in the troubleshooting section. By systematically disabling extensions, you can isolate which pair or group is causing the conflict.
Once identified, you may need to choose between the conflicting extensions, look for alternative extensions that don’t overlap in functionality, or check if the extensions’ developers offer settings to mitigate conflicts. Sometimes, simply updating one or both extensions can resolve compatibility issues.
Optimizing Browser Performance with Extension Management
The number and type of extensions you have installed can significantly impact your browser’s speed and resource consumption. Proactive management is key to maintaining optimal performance.
Minimizing Resource Usage
Each extension running in your browser consumes a small amount of RAM and CPU power. While individual extensions might have a negligible impact, a large collection can noticeably slow down Edge and your computer.
Regularly review your installed extensions and remove any that you no longer use or need. Disable extensions that are only occasionally required. Consider using lightweight alternatives if a feature-rich extension is proving to be a resource hog.
You can monitor extension resource usage by opening the Task Manager within Edge. Press `Shift + Esc` while Edge is open, or go to More tools > Task manager. This will show you the memory and CPU usage for each extension, helping you identify the most demanding ones.
Curating Your Extension Library
Think of your extensions as a curated toolkit. Only keep the tools that genuinely add value to your browsing experience or are essential for your workflow.
Before installing a new extension, ask yourself if you truly need it. Research alternatives and read reviews to gauge its effectiveness and potential impact on performance. Prioritize extensions from reputable developers with clear privacy policies.
Periodically revisit your installed extensions. A quick audit every few months can help you declutter your browser and ensure you’re only running the most beneficial add-ons.
By diligently managing your extensions—adding wisely, removing ruthlessly, and disabling strategically—you can transform Microsoft Edge into a highly efficient, personalized, and powerful browsing tool tailored precisely to your needs.